Why “No Playthrough” is the Holy Grail for UK Players
I cannot stress this enough. The standard industry bonus is a nightmare. You get 100 spins, win £30, but then you see the tiny text: “40x wagering on winnings.” That means you need to bet £1,200 before you can withdraw. Who has time for that? It is designed to make you lose it back. That is why the idea of a NySpins casino free spins no playthrough UK deal is so attractive. It means what you win is yours. Full stop. No hidden maths. The Reality Check: NySpins Casino Free Spins No Playthrough UK T&Cs
Alright, let us talk about the small print. I hate that we have to do this, but it is the only way to avoid disappointment. When you see a NySpins casino free spins no playthrough UK offer, here are the three things you must check before you click “Claim”:
- The Game Lock: Sometimes the spins are only on a specific game like “Book of Dead” or “Big Bass Bonanza.” If you hate that game, the offer is useless to you. Check the promo page.
- The Time Limit: I saw one offer that gave 20 spins with no wagering, but you had to use them within 24 hours of depositing. If you deposit on Friday night and forget until Sunday, they are gone. Set a timer on your phone.
- The Max Win Cap: This is the big one. Even if there is “no playthrough,” there is usually a cap on how much you can win from those spins. I have seen caps as low as £50 and as high as £250. You are not going to become a millionaire from a 10p spin, but you can walk away with a nice dinner bill covered.
I also noticed that the “no playthrough” offers are often reserved for specific payment methods. For example, using PayPal or Skrill sometimes excludes you from the bonus. Using a debit card (Visa/Mastercard) usually works fine. Always check the “Bonus T&Cs” tab on the NySpins website. It takes five minutes, but it saves you from screaming at your screen later.
Let me be contradictory for a second. I actually found one offer that had a “1x wagering” requirement. That is essentially no playthrough. It is a technicality. They say “no playthrough” but then write “1x wagering on winnings.” It is the same thing. Do not be scared by that wording. It just means you have to spin the winnings one time before you can withdraw. That takes two seconds. Compare that to the 35x wagering at other casinos, and it is a dream.
